Cricket News: IPL 2023 TV ratings up 25 per cent compared to 2022 – Disney Star | IPL 2023 TV ratings up compared to 2022
The Broadcast Audience Research Council (BARC) India revealed that the first ten matches of the ongoing Indian Premier League (IPL) season attracted over 30 crore viewers on Star Sports, the official TV broadcaster for the tournament.
Star Sports recorded 6,230 crore minutes of watch time for the initial ten games of the campaign. Accordingly, the channel garnered around 23 per cent more viewers than IPL 2022. The average watch time of the live broadcast has also shot up by 25 per cent in comparison to the previous campaign of the IPL.
Further, the BARC data says that the same ten games attained a peak concurrency of 5.6 crores on TV at a time when the number stood at 1.8 crores on digital.
“Additionally, Tata IPL on Star Sports delivered 14 crore viewers on opening day with a peak concurrency of 5.6 crores and an engagement of 76 minutes. Star Sports is optimistic that its efforts will continue to keep fans glued to their TV screens and create an unforgettable viewing experience that celebrates the spirit of IPL 2023,” the official statement from Disney Star read.
The TVR rating for IPL 2023 has also increased by 25 per cent from last year to 5.1 this season. The TV ratings enhanced by 31 per cent whereas the overall reach increased by 20 per cent for the broadcaster for the opening game of the season between the Chennai Super Kings (CSK) and the Gujarat Titans (GT) at the Narendra Modi Stadium in Ahmedabad on March 30.

IPL 2023 ratings: JioCinema boasts clocking record figures
At the same time, the official digital rights holder JioCinema revealed that they had around six crore unique users tuning into the CSK v GT game. Also, their total match views had surpassed the 50 crore mark that day.
